Why are veneers so expensive?

You noticed, porcelain veneers are more expensive but there is a reason; they look more natural and last far longer than their resin plastic counterparts. An average set of porcelain dental veneers will last about 10-15 years. Some veneers can last as long as 20 or 25 years.

How much does it cost to get perfect teeth?

image

Many dentists are now recommending services such as veneers: thin, porcelain covers placed over the fronts of teeth, which can cost between $1,000 and $3,000 per tooth. Bonding is similar to veneers but less permanent and costs between $500 and $750 per tooth.

Tooth Damages-- there is also a threat of dentin damages after veneer positioning, yet it is less common. During the enamel removal procedure, it is possible for the underlying dentin to obtain damaged. An inadequately fitted veneer can likewise transform the placement of an individual's bite, resulting in tooth sensitivity, bruxism, or jaw discomfort. How much is a full set of veneers in Thailand?

Porcelain Veneers Thailand – Cost Comparison

If you are opting for the porcelain veneers, it can cost upward of $1,900 dollars per tooth, and the composite veneers are around $800 per tooth. In Thailand, composite veneers can cost from $250-300 per tooth, and porcelain veneers $350-$450.

How much veneers cost in USA?

Generally, dental veneers range in cost from as low as $400 to as high as $2,500 per tooth. Composite veneers are the least expensive veneer option, generally ranging from $400-$1,500 per tooth, whereas porcelain veneers generally cost between $925 to $2,500 per tooth.
